FACILITIES TICKET — Temporary Site Access

While the Bram Court office is under renovation, all contractor work for the Quillon Build project moves to the temporary site at Harrow Annexe. Park in the gravel lot and sign in at the portable cabin. The annexe side door is keypad-controlled; enter using the temporary contractor code below.

door code, yagap-bahof: bdg-O-05

The renewal of our three-year agreement with Torvane Materials has been assessed in detail. Proposed terms include a 4.2% unit-price increase, partially offset by improved volume rebates and extended payment terms of sixty days. Sensitivity analysis indicates a net annual cost impact of under 1% on the Meridia product line, assuming stable demand. Legal has flagged no material changes to liability clauses. We recommend approval, subject to the conditions outlined in the confidential note below.

confidential, yawip-bahif: Zorokox Partners plans to lower the Casax list price by 28.0 percent in April. The board signed off on a budget of $271.0 million for Project Juldor. The renewal with Pelokox Partners closes at $410.1 million a year, 3.4 percent below the last contract. Project Pelok slips by a full year because of the audit delay.

**Release checklist — Cartwheel Checkout v4.2**

- [ ] Confirm the load test against the staging checkout flow completed a full 45-minute soak at 3x projected peak traffic, with p99 latency under 800ms and zero dropped payment intents. Please verify the Grindle harness used the updated cart-abandonment scenario, not the legacy script. The run that must be reviewed is identified by the trace token below.

session token of bawep-yadup = htk21_528abd376e3c5a4ec24a1

**Internal Memo — Divestment of Calloway Unit**

Finance team: heads-up that the Calloway instruments unit is being sold to Thornbeck Holdings, pending diligence. Keep its ledgers ring-fenced from month-end consolidation and route any buyer queries through Magda. Timeline and strategic reasoning are set out in the confidential note below.

confidential, bafog-kaweg: Headcount on the Ulaael team goes from 7 to 140 by the end of April. Gross margin on Ulaael came in at 15 percent against a plan of 15 percent.